Exterior Dimensions
The Escalade's imposing exterior dimensions contribute to its spacious interior. Here’s a general overview of the exterior dimensions. Keep in mind that these dimensions can vary slightly based on the model year and specific trim. The length of the Escalade typically ranges from 211.9 inches to 212.0 inches (approximately 17.7 to 17.7 feet). The width (excluding mirrors) is usually around 81.1 inches (about 6.8 feet), making it a wide vehicle on the road. The height varies between 76.4 inches and 76.6 inches (roughly 6.4 feet), depending on the model and trim. These numbers highlight the Escalade's substantial size. Engine Options and Power
The Escalade is typically offered with a powerful V8 engine, known for its strong performance and reliability. The engine is typically a 6.2-liter V8, which delivers impressive horsepower and torque. This engine provides brisk acceleration and ample power for towing and hauling. Another option is the Duramax 3.0L Turbo-Diesel. This engine provides excellent fuel efficiency and strong low-end torque. The Escalade's engine options are designed to provide a balance of power and efficiency. Transmission and Drivetrain
The Escalade is typically paired with a smooth-shifting automatic transmission, ensuring a seamless driving experience. The Escalade usually comes with rear-wheel drive (RWD) as standard, with four-wheel drive (4WD) available as an option. The 4WD system enhances traction and stability, making it ideal for various driving conditions. The Escalade's transmission and drivetrain work together to deliver optimal performance. Safety and Driver-Assistance Features
Safety is a top priority in the Cadillac Escalade. The Escalade is equipped with a comprehensive suite of driver-assistance features, including automatic emergency braking, lane-keeping assist, adaptive cruise control, and blind-spot monitoring. These features enhance safety and provide peace of mind on the road. The Escalade also includes advanced safety features, such as multiple airbags and a reinforced safety cage, to protect occupants in the event of a collision.
